Automated Guided Vehicles (AGV) play a pivotal role in modern industrial automation, enhancing efficiency and productivity. A critical aspect of AGVs is their wheels, which vary in design and function to suit specific applications. This article explores various types of AGV wheels, including differential wheels, driven wheels, and horizontal steering wheels, as well as the importance of choosing the right manufacturer and materials.

Types of AGV Wheels

1. Differential Wheels

Differential wheels are designed to allow AGVs to pivot and turn smoothly, making them ideal for navigating tight spaces. These wheels enable independent movement, which enhances maneuverability in complex environments like warehouses or manufacturing floors.

2. Driven Wheels

Driven wheels are the primary source of propulsion for AGVs. These wheels are powered by motors and are responsible for moving the vehicle forward or backward. The design of driven wheels can significantly impact the vehicle's overall performance, especially when it comes to load capacity and speed.

3. Horizontal Steering Wheels

Horizontal steering wheels are essential for AGVs that require precise directional control. These wheels enable the vehicle to make sharp turns and navigate tight corners, which is particularly important in environments with limited space.

Suspension and Automation

AGV wheel suspension systems can enhance the vehicle’s stability and performance. A well-designed suspension helps absorb shocks and reduces wear on wheels, improving the overall ride quality. This is especially important in automated settings where precision and stability are paramount.

Applications of AGV Wheels

AGV wheels are used in various sectors, including:

  • Manufacturing: For transporting materials and products along production lines.
  • Warehousing: To move goods efficiently within distribution centers.
  • Healthcare: For transporting supplies and medications within hospitals.
